An architect is designing a multi-tenant Palo Alto Networks NGFW deployment using Virtual Systems (vsys). Each vsys requires its own isolated set of administrators, security policies, and network interfaces. Which configuration constraint must the architect keep in mind regarding WildFire and Decryption properties in a vsys architecture?

Correct answer & explanation

Physical interfaces can be allocated exclusively to a vsys or shared, and cryptographic profiles can be shared or defined locally per vsys.

Some features like WildFire, GlobalProtect portal, and certain cryptographic profiles can be shared or configured globally, but vsys have specific rules regarding interface allocation and shared objects. Specifically, physical interfaces must be assigned to specific vsys or shared, and WildFire can be configured globally or per vsys depending on PAN-OS version.

  • Panorama cannot manage firewalls configured with virtual systems.

    Why it's wrong here

    Panorama fully supports managing vsys-enabled firewalls.

  • Virtual systems cannot have separate security policies; all policies are strictly global.

    Why it's wrong here

    The primary purpose of vsys is policy and administrative isolation.

  • Decryption is impossible on virtual systems.

    Why it's wrong here

    Decryption is fully supported on virtual systems.

  • Physical interfaces can be allocated exclusively to a vsys or shared, and cryptographic profiles can be shared or defined locally per vsys.

    Why this is correct

    Virtual systems allow granular allocation of physical interfaces, security policies, and shared/local object structures.
